Screen Displays To display the date and time on a E connected TV, press the wireless controller's DATA CODE button. Press the wireless controller's TV SCREEN button to see the other displays on the TV screen. (The displays appear white on-screen.) They will not be added to any recordings you make with the camera. indicates a flashing display. TV SCREEN DATA CODE Turning off the LCD screen displays You can turn off the displays to give you a clear screen for playback. Set the camera to VCR mode, open the VCR menu (page 26) and choose the DISPLAYS option. Set the displays to OFF and then close the menu. • The LCD screen will now be completely blank, but the camera will continue to show warning/caution displays when necessary.
